Realistic Environmental Integration

The primary function of this resource pack is to break the rigid rules of vanilla block rendering. In the base game, snow only appears on specific top surfaces like grass or farmland, leaving stone roofs and cobblestone paths unnaturally clean during winter. This pack changes that behavior by rendering snow accumulations on wood, stone, and various construction materials when adjacent to snow layers. Similarly, moss textures now creep over neighboring blocks, creating the convincing illusion of long-abandoned structures being reclaimed by nature.

This approach preserves the iconic aesthetic of the game while adding significant depth. Whether you are exploring a taiga village or constructing a jungle temple, the added details make the environment feel alive. The pack does not introduce new block IDs; instead, it reinterprets current assets through advanced model layering. This ensures full compatibility with existing worlds and server environments that permit client-side visual modifications.

Performance Considerations and Optimization

Utilizing transparent layers and complex models inevitably places a higher demand on the rendering engine. Users should be aware of potential technical nuances such as z-fighting, where overlapping textures may flicker if viewed from extreme angles. However, the developers have minimized this effect to less than a pixel, making it nearly imperceptible during normal gameplay. A more notable issue involves lighting calculations near these overlay blocks, which can sometimes behave erratically in the pure vanilla engine.

To ensure the best experience, it is highly recommended to pair this resource pack with performance-enhancing mods like Optifine or Sodium (Rubidium). These tools not only resolve minor lighting artifacts but also compensate for the additional graphical load, ensuring smooth frame rates on both mid-range and high-end systems.
